Mount Desert Island Birds:  White-winged Crossbill

Town Hill 2013, Hancock, US-ME
Jan 13, 2013 10:10 AM - 12:10 PM
Protocol: Traveling
3.0 mile(s)
Comments: A little pishing and all of a sudden a pile of White-winged Crossbills.
10 species

Mallard (Anas platyrhynchos) 2
Herring Gull (Larus argentatus) 1
Hairy Woodpecker (Picoides villosus) 2
Pileated Woodpecker (Dryocopus pileatus) 1 calling
American Crow (Corvus brachyrhynchos) 7
Common Raven (Corvus corax) 1
Black-capped Chickadee (Poecile atricapillus) 18
Red-breasted Nuthatch (Sitta canadensis) 4

White-winged Crossbill (Loxia leucoptera) 5 Type 1 calling. On the corner of Knox Road and Gilbert Farm these bird pished easily. Food seems plentiful in the copious spruce
American Goldfinch (Spinus tristis) 1

Clark Cove 2013, Hancock, US-ME
Jan 13, 2013 11:02 AM - 11:22 AM
Protocol: Stationary
Comments: Nico and I working the Clark Cove coastal edge. A Bald Eagle showed up and all hell broke loose with the 65 Herring Gull roosting on the ice all taking flight along with 30 American Black Duck. Gray Day and 40F. Foggy and dreary. Uck!
10 species

American Black Duck (Anas rubripes) 30
Mallard (Anas platyrhynchos) 2
Red-breasted Merganser (Mergus serrator) 1
Bald Eagle (Haliaeetus leucocephalus) 1 flew in from south to north towards the head of the island 11:05
Herring Gull (Larus argentatus) 65
Great Black-backed Gull (Larus marinus) 3
American Crow (Corvus brachyrhynchos) 11
Black-capped Chickadee (Poecile atricapillus) 9
Red-breasted Nuthatch (Sitta canadensis) 2
American Goldfinch (Spinus tristis) 1
